How Crypto Data Analytics Is Shaping the Future of Decentralized Finance (DeFi)

As decentralized finance (DeFi) continues to revolutionize traditional financial systems, the role of crypto data analytics is becoming increasingly pivotal. The intersection of these two domains is not only enhancing the efficiency of financial transactions but also driving innovation in risk management, investment strategies, and user experience.

Crypto data analytics refers to the process of collecting, analyzing, and interpreting data from various blockchain networks to derive actionable insights. This growing field leverages advanced technologies such as machine learning and artificial intelligence to sift through vast amounts of data, enabling participants in the DeFi ecosystem to make informed decisions.

One of the most significant impacts of crypto data analytics in DeFi is its ability to enhance market transparency. By providing real-time information about liquidity, trading volumes, and price movements, analytics tools equip investors with the knowledge needed to navigate the often volatile crypto markets. Furthermore, this transparency fosters greater trust among users, helping DeFi platforms attract and retain more participants.

Another critical area where data analytics plays a crucial role is risk assessment and management. Through sophisticated algorithms, projects in the DeFi space can analyze historical data to identify potential risks and volatility patterns. This predictive capability enables developers and investors to create more resilient financial products and mitigate exposures effectively. For instance, credit scoring models can benefit from these insights, allowing platforms to determine user eligibility for loans based on their transaction history and behavior.

Data analytics also paves the way for personalized user experiences in DeFi applications. By analyzing user behavior and preferences, platforms can tailor their offerings to meet individual needs. This level of customization improves user satisfaction, ultimately leading to higher engagement rates and increased overall adoption of DeFi solutions.

Moreover, crypto data analytics helps facilitate smart contract optimization. With detailed analytics, developers can analyze transaction performance and identify inefficiencies in smart contracts. This continuous improvement process ensures that DeFi applications are not only functional but also optimized for user convenience and cost-effectiveness.

The integration of decentralized oracle networks, which connect smart contracts with external data sources, further enhances the capabilities of crypto data analytics. These oracles provide essential real-world data that can be analyzed alongside on-chain data, resulting in more informed decision-making processes. This integration is particularly crucial for constructing and managing various DeFi products such as derivatives and insurance.

Looking ahead, the future of decentralized finance will heavily rely on advanced crypto data analytics tools and platforms. Innovations such as predictive analytics and on-chain analysis will further refine users' investment strategies and risk management practices. As DeFi matures, the ability to effectively interpret and leverage data will distinguish successful projects from those that struggle to gain traction.

In conclusion, crypto data analytics not only shapes the current landscape of decentralized finance but also dictates its future trajectory. By promoting transparency, enabling risk management, enhancing user experiences, and optimizing smart contracts, analytics will continue to play a vital role in the growth and evolution of the DeFi sector.
